veryyy easy to do it yourself.. honestly follow directions on the liquid DYE and just make sure you have bleach. Do it in the washer- takes 30 mins, and the dye is usually only $4 at craft stores ( unless you use coupon like me) i bought 2 but it was soo easy and quick
i did mine and i love it ( mine is a wine/deep purplish color)..if youd like i can take pics and post later
@aprilc12: I did mine in the tub with super hot water and just rinsed it really well afterwards until the water ran clean. I never used the washer and it doesn't seem to rub off on anything.
I guess I could try it in the rubbermaid tubs like these girls have been doing. you need to use HOT water right?
super hot water.. i used my own washer.. and then you run a reg load with 1-2 cups of bleach afterwards..trust me ladies this works!
